Then I got to go down to MO and AR over winter break. I hung out with good friends Todd and Angie. The day after I got there Todd, Fuller, Pico and I went down to Horseshoe Canyon Ranch (HCR) in AR to climb. The first day we spent bouldering. The picture below is of Fuller and I doing just that.



The photo below is the next day walking up to Insanity Cliffs climbing area. HCR is a working ranch so there are horses, dogs, goats, sheep and many other types of animals running around.



The next photo is Fuller belaying me up a 4 star 5.10b climb called Emotional Content. A wonderful climb.
